CELEBRATING…the golden anniversary of the Devil’s Sinkhole being named a National Natural Landmark…IYCK e International Year of Caves and Karst…the twentieth year of the Devil’s Sinkhole Society, the volunteer group that provides tours to the Devil’s Sinkhole State Natural Area…neighbor national natural landmarks and parks…First nations that roamed the area over 14,000 years…and BATS.
The Buffalo Soldiers troop will also be on site sharing the history of the Buffalo Soldiers as they roamed and patrolled this area of Texas during the Indian Wars campaign.

Stargazing with the San Antonio Astronomical Association will start when darkness is adequate after the bat show.

A Texas Parks bat expert will present a program at the Rocksprings School Auditorium at 11 A.M. and repeat the program at 1:30 P.M.
